![]() We will use one of these exporters, namely yet-another-cloudwatch-exporter, to get metrics from AWS CloudWatch. Prometheus exporters gather metrics from services and publish them in a standardized format that both a Prometheus server and the Sysdig Agent can scrape natively. With Prometheus, you can gather metrics from your whole infrastructure which may be spread across multiple cloud providers, following a single-pane-of-glass approach. Prometheus is a leading open source monitoring solution which provides means to easily create integrations by writing exporters. ![]() The AWS CloudWatch service can gather the metrics that Fargate containers generate under the namespace ECS/ContainerInsights, if it’s turned on for a particular cluster, by using Fargate. CloudWatch is a tool that provides metrics to monitor Fargate and other AWS services. This way, they spend only the amount of resources that they need. AWS Fargate and PrometheusĪWS Fargate is a serverless service that enables customers to run containers with computational capacity specified by the user. ![]() So, how can you monitor AWS Fargate and other serverless services if you can’t install the Sysdig agent on them? We’ll need to rely on an intermediary like AWS CloudWatch, the monitoring service of Amazon. One of them is that Fargate does not allow privileged pods. But the pods deployed in Fargate have some limitations. Once these services become part of the business, they need to be monitored the same as any other production workload to ensure their health and performance. Support for a Kubernetes environment gives developers more options to deploy Fargate services, including a standardized Kubernetes API. Developers have been able to use AWS Fargate on ECS for a while, and recently, Fargate was also released for EKS. By leveraging AWS Fargate for automatic management of compute infrastructure, developers can increase the speed in which they develop and deploy code. This service alleviates the need for developers to manage container infrastructure by leaving it to the cloud provider. Watch our on-demand webinar, where we share our experience using Prometheus at scale, providing different solutions and highlighting the challenges to solve in each step:Ĭloud Native Monitoring: Scaling Prometheus →Ĭurrently, we are witnessing the rise of serverless computing, such as AWS Fargate. Having trouble scaling Prometheus monitoring?
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|